Setting Your Limits Early
One of the first pieces of advice I wish I had embraced more seriously was the importance of setting clear limits. This concept extends beyond simply deciding how much money I was willing to spend. It encompasses establishing boundaries around time, emotional investment, and financial expenditures. Before I even sat at a table, I carefully crafted a budget: How much could I afford to risk? What amount, if lost, would I consider acceptable?
Alongside budgeting, I made a commitment to myself to limit my playing time. At first, this felt a bit confining—who wants to think about the clock when they’re enjoying a game? Yet, with time, I’ve realized that knowing when to step away has transformed my sessions into far more enjoyable experiences—and has provided me with the clarity needed to recognize when it’s time to gracefully exit.

Taking Frequent Breaks
One of the best practices I’ve woven into my online poker routine is the habit of taking regular breaks. In the past, I’d find myself glued to the screen for hours, fully engrossed in the action. However, I quickly learned that fatigue can dull my judgment and impair my performance. Online poker requires sharp observation and keen anticipation, skills that tend to wane when we’re tired.
To counter this, I began scheduling intentional breaks—stepping away to stretch, snack, or simply take a breather. These breaks have provided me with not only physical relief but also mental clarity. Often, after a quick pause, I find myself returning to the table refreshed and focused. Trust me, this simple practice can significantly boost your overall enjoyment of the game.
Utilizing Tools for Responsible Gambling
In today’s digital landscape, a host of tools and features can aid players in managing their gambling activities. Most online poker platforms now offer options to set deposit limits, loss thresholds, and even reminders to take breaks. Embracing these features was a turning point for me. Rather than relying solely on my willpower to regulate my play, these tools function as an invaluable safety net.
Utilizing self-check tools has kept me aware of my habits and fueled my motivation to remain in control. When I hit my limit or the software kindly nudges me to take a breather, it serves as a timely reminder that I’m in command of my gaming experience.
